RE: What's the difference between the forums and the blogs on CS?

I think that one has more control over their blogs than threads. You can delete the blog or even some posts on the blog (I think). You can also disable comments, making it a sort of a diary. On forums you can only hide comments or ban someone from your thread, but you have no control over your thread. You cannot close it or delete it.

I think that people tend to be more serious on blogs. It's easier to discuss any serious topic there. Forums are much more dynamic, with more controversial and funny threads. People talk more openly on forums, they are less polite, more direct, but also - I would say - less vain. Nobody cares whether their threads are 'popular', have a dozen or hundreds of posts, who posted and what was posted - as long as the discussion is going on. Blogs are much smaller community and people are more sensitive to 'popularity' and interpersonal relationships.

In general, I think that CS community is not that large - at least people who more or less regularly post on forums and blogs - and very soon get to know each other. It would be nice if CS would have more members from various countries. It would be much more interesting. I think that - due to CS being a small community - people get bored easily - both on blogs and forums.

RE: Language

From some reason, one cannot use other alphabets on CS. They always appear as ?????? . Maybe because the site is old so it does not support other languages... confused

I tried to type a message in Japanese once and it also turned out like: ?????? laugh So does the Cyrillic alphabet, apparently. laugh
